From my notes:

KGr. z.b.V. O.B.S.
Kampfgruppe z.b.V. Oberbefehlshaber Süd
(Unit Code: used factory codes)

Formation. (Jan 43)
Formed on or about 1 January 1943 in Italy (probably Fp. Comiso/SE Sicily) and equipped with He 111s. Nothing has been found on this provisional transport unit other than the 5 loss entries noted below. Its origin and composition remain a mystery. Presumably it was hastily assembled under the authority of Oberbefehlshaber Süd (a.k.a. Luftflottenkdo. 2) using a number of He 111 replacement aircraft parked at a depot in Foggia or Bari. In any event, it does not seem to have existed for more than two weeks.

Italy and North Africa. (Jan 43)
2 Jan 43: He 111 damaged taxiing at Fp. Comiso/Sicily, 20%.1
4 Jan 43: He 111 crash landed at Fp. Lecce/S Italy, 15%.
5 Jan 43: He 111 (VG+IJ) destroyed in a mid-air collision west of Linosa Is. halfway between Sicily and Tunisia, 100%, 4 MIA.
6 Jan 43: He 111 hit by a truck at Fp. Comiso, 20%.
12 Jan 43: He 111 (SM+KO) crashed into the sea between Comiso and Tripoli, 100%, Oblt. Rudi Resch plus 3 others MIA.

FpN: (none)
